Description
4-Bromophenylhydrazine hydrochloride (CAS No. 41931-18-4) is a high-purity organic compound with the molecular formula C6H8BrClN2, widely used in pharmaceutical and chemical research. This white to off-white crystalline powder is a derivative of phenylhydrazine, featuring a bromine substituent at the para-position, enhancing its reactivity in synthetic applications. With a molecular weight of 223.50 g/mol, it is soluble in water and polar organic solvents, making it versatile for laboratory use. Ideal for coupling reactions, heterocycle synthesis, and as a precursor for dyes and agrochemicals, this reagent is rigorously tested for quality (HPLC, NMR) to ensure consistency. Store in a cool, dry place under inert conditions to maintain stability.

Application
4-Bromophenylhydrazine hydrochloride is a key intermediate in the synthesis of indoles, pyrazoles, and other nitrogen-containing heterocycles, which are foundational structures in drug discovery. It is employed in the preparation of dyes, pigments, and agrochemicals due to its reactive hydrazine moiety. Researchers also utilize it in cross-coupling reactions to introduce bromophenyl groups into complex molecules. Its stability and solubility make it suitable for both small-scale and industrial applications.
Safety and Hazards
GHS Hazard Statements
- H302 (17.6%): Harmful if swallowed [Warning Acute toxicity, oral]
- H314 (84.3%): Causes severe skin burns and eye damage [Danger Skin corrosion/irritation]
- H315 (15.7%): Causes skin irritation [Warning Skin corrosion/irritation]
- H319 (15.7%): Causes serious eye irritation [Warning Serious eye damage/eye irritation]
- H335 (13.7%): May cause respiratory irritation [Warning Specific target organ toxicity, single exposure; Respiratory tract irritation]
